An industrial plant manufactures photovoltaic cells using three separate production lines: Alpha (AAA), Beta (BBB), and Gamma (GGG). The proportions of the total output produced by each line are 0.45, 0.30, and 0.25 respectively. Data shows that the probability of a cell being defective (DDD) from Line Alpha is 0.02, from Line Beta is 0.04, and from Line Gamma is 0.06.
Construct a tree diagram to represent the production process and the associated defect probabilities.
Calculate the probability that a randomly selected cell: (i) was produced by Line Gamma and is defective, (ii) is not defective.
A quality control inspector finds a defective cell. Determine the probability that this cell was not produced by Line Alpha.
